SAP Advantage Database Server seems to be discontinued. Therefore it is excluded from the DB-Engines Ranking.
DescriptionBigchainDB is scalable blockchain database offering decentralization, immutability and native assetsA high performant, light-weight, embedded key-value database libraryLow-cost RDBMS with access to ISAM and FoxPro data structuresTime Series DBMS and big data platformA lightweight, in-memory graph engine that serves as a reference implementation of the TinkerPop3 API
Primary database modelDocument storeKey-value storeRelational DBMSTime Series DBMSGraph DBMS
